Wheelchair ride reality in Milton
Milton has real wheelchair coverage in the current Canada provider snapshot, but confirmation still depends on whether the passenger stays in the chair, needs stair help, or is travelling into another GTA market.
Because Milton sits on the west GTA edge, a wheelchair trip may be priced and scheduled like a regional corridor ride even when the destination is still inside Halton. That is especially true when pickup timing is tight, the provider must wait through a discharge process, or the trip is outside a simple there-and-back daytime window.
- Milton Transit provides regular service and accessible Milton access+ service, and the town says the system connects riders to GO Transit, Brampton Transit, and MiWay, which reinforces that many Milton medical trips are regional rather than single-campus local rides.
- The Town of Milton says all GO train connections happen at Milton GO Station on Main Street East, and town transit also connects at the 401 Park & Ride, so eastbound Mississauga and Toronto-linked planning often shares the same corridor pressure as daily commuter traffic.
- Halton Healthcare says after-hours access at Milton District Hospital is through the Emergency Department, so discharge pickups can require exact entrance, handoff, and patient-ready timing rather than a generic main-door pickup.

What changes wheelchair pricing in Milton
Wheelchair quotes in Milton change with the route length, whether the passenger must stay in the chair, how long the provider is expected to wait, and whether the trip remains inside Milton or runs into Oakville, Mississauga, Burlington, or Hamilton. Parking and discharge timing can matter even on relatively short mileage.
- Short Milton rides can still quote higher when the passenger must remain in a wheelchair, the provider must wait through a discharge window, or the pickup involves stairs or townhouse access.
- Regional Milton trips to Oakville, Burlington, Mississauga, or Hamilton are usually priced on total route time and whether the provider starts inside Milton or deadheads from a nearby market.
- Hospital parking costs and caregiver waiting time can make a one-way private-pay discharge or dialysis ride more practical than separate family driving trips.

FAQ
Questions about Milton medical rides
- Can a wheelchair passenger stay in the chair during a Milton ride?
- Often yes, but the provider has to confirm that the passenger can safely remain seated in the wheelchair for the full route and that the pickup and destination access fit the vehicle.
- Can I request a wheelchair ride from Milton to Credit Valley Hospital?
- Yes. Milton-to-Mississauga wheelchair requests can be submitted through the Canada quote flow. Final price and timing depend on the route, passenger needs, and provider confirmation.
- What details should I include for a Milton wheelchair request?
- Include the exact pickup and drop-off addresses, whether the passenger stays in the chair, whether there are stairs, whether a caregiver is travelling, and whether the trip is one-way, round-trip, or tied to a discharge or appointment window.
